Marie Isaak

Biography

Marie (Mary) Isaak was the roughly sixteen-year-old daughter of the anarchist publishers Abraham and Mary Isaak. She was detained at a Chicago police station in the September 1901 roundup that followed the shooting of President McKinley; her case was dismissed by September 10, 1901.
